Plywood and LVL — Export value in Mexico
Mexico: Plywood and LVL — Export value was 7,424 1000 USD in 2024. ◆ Volatile
Plywood and LVL — Export value in Mexico, 1961–2024
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Measured in 1000 USD.
Analysis
The most recent figure for plywood and lvl — export value in Mexico is 7,424 1000 USD, measured in 2024.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 38.3% on the previous year and down 11.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, plywood and lvl — export value in Mexico peaked at 18,282 1000 USD in 2021 and was at its lowest, 13 1000 USD, in 1975.
That places Mexico 71st out of 232 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 477.78 1000 USD | 246 1000 USD | 832 1000 USD | 9 |
| 1970s | 700.1 1000 USD | 13 1000 USD | 2,849 1000 USD | 10 |
| 1980s | 4,975 1000 USD | 132 1000 USD | 9,451 1000 USD | 10 |
| 1990s | 3,912 1000 USD | 559 1000 USD | 10,425 1000 USD | 10 |
| 2000s | 3,400 1000 USD | 799 1000 USD | 7,489 1000 USD | 10 |
| 2010s | 4,077 1000 USD | 1,466 1000 USD | 9,483 1000 USD | 10 |
| 2020s | 13,251 1000 USD | 7,424 1000 USD | 18,282 1000 USD | 5 |

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
